The following information is obtained in the compression test on limestone as the sectional area of the sample is 50 mm² and the length 1000 mm, draw the stress- strain curve and then determine the value of proportional limit, yield stress and ultimate strength, failure stress, and modulus of elasticity. Load (KN) Extension (mm) Load (KN) Extension (mm) Compressive Stress, o (MPa) 50 5 238 45 100 10 250 50 150 15 275 60 200 20 295 80 220 25 300 100 Axial Strain, & (%) 225 30 290 120 231 33 275 136 232 36 240 150 233 40 225 160
